#d1f780 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d1f780 is composed of 82% red, 96.9%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 48.2%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 79.2 degrees, a saturation of 88.1% and a lightness of 73.5%. #d1f780 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a3ef01. Closest websafe color is: #ccff99.

#d1f780 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d1f780 has RGB values of R:209, G:247, B:128 and CMYK values of C:0.15, M:0, Y:0.48,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 13760384.
